Memorials are private property owned by each individual and are not insured by the cemetery against damage caused by others,  although they can be insured under an individual’s personal policy. In the case of vandalism, which is an unfortunate fact of life in our society, the cemetery will try to repair any damaged memorial for the lot holder but cannot assume responsibility for damage.
